Skip to content

Commit 838ef39

Browse files
authored
sasl-3.1: add example with split client response (#521)
1 parent 515fdab commit 838ef39

File tree

1 file changed

+9
-0
lines changed

1 file changed

+9
-0
lines changed

extensions/sasl-3.1.md

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-185,6 +185,15 @@ an additional capability.
185185
S: :jaguar.test 001 jilles :Welcome to the jillestest Internet Relay Chat Network jilles
186186
(usual welcome messages)
187187

188+
The client is using a long password and splits its response into two chunks.
189+
190+
C: AUTHENTICATE PLAIN
191+
S: AUTHENTICATE +
192+
C: AUTHENTICATE AGVtZXJzaW9uAEVzdCB1dCBiZWF0YWUgb21uaXMgaXBzYW0uIFF1aXMgZnVnaWF0IGRlbGVuaXRpIHRvdGFtIHF1aS4gSXBzdW0gcXVhbSBhIGRvbG9ydW0gdGVtcG9yYSB2ZWxpdCBsYWJvcnVtIG9kaXQuIEV0IHNhZXBlIHZvbHVwdGF0ZSBzZWQgY3VtcXVlIHZlbC4gVm9sdXB0YXMgc2ludCBhYiBwYXJpYXR1ciBsaWJlcm8gdmVyaXRhdGlzIGNvcnJ1cHRpLiBWZXJvIGl1cmUgb21uaXMgdWxsYW0uIFZlcm8gYmVhdGFlIGRvbG9yZXMgZmFjZXJlIGZ1Z2lhdCBpcHNhbS4gRWEgZXN0IHBhcmlhdHVyIG1pbmltYSBub2JpcyBz
193+
C: AUTHENTICATE dW50IGF1dCB1dC4gRG9sb3JlcyB1dCBsYXVkYW50aXVtIG1haW9yZXMgdGVtcG9yaWJ1cyB2b2x1cHRhdGVzLiBSZWljaWVuZGlzIGltcGVkaXQgb21uaXMgZXQgdW5kZSBkZWxlY3R1cyBxdWFzIGFiLiBRdWFlIGVsaWdlbmRpIG5lY2Vzc2l0YXRpYnVzIGRvbG9yaWJ1cyBtb2xlc3RpYXMgdGVtcG9yYSBtYWduYW0gYXNzdW1lbmRhLg==
194+
S: :irc.example.org 900 emersion [email protected] emersion :You are now logged in as emersion
195+
S: :irc.example.org 903 emersion :SASL authentication successful
196+
188197
## Numerics used by this extension
189198

190199
`900` aka `RPL_LOGGEDIN` is sent when the user's account name is set (whether by SASL or otherwise).

0 commit comments

Comments
 (0)